Anyway...on to my story....I started noticing my hair loss around Nov of 2008 (a little after my 25th birthday). Everyone said I was going crazy, but I was the one looking at my hair everyday and I knew that it was thinning. I didn't really do anything about it for awhile thinking that it was a normal part of getting older until it REALLY started to thin.

Fast forward about a year and a couple of doctors and I got a prescription for Propecia. I didn't seem to have any of the side effects that people complain about, which is cool, but I also hadn't really noticed any change in my hair loss since I started. I dont really have any receding at all, just thinning (I guess this is called diffuse thinning???).

Fast forward again....about a month ago, I started using Rogaine foam twice a day as well. This stuff is making my hair fall out even faster! I know that there is supposed to be a shedding period and I'm trying to wait it out, but it is hard. It seems that there is a direct correlation between how much I use and how much falls out. Has anyone else noticed this? The more I apply/use, the more hair i see in the sink and all over my hands. It has gotten to the point where I decided to create an account to ask you guys for advice. I'll try and get some pictures up as soon as I can, but has anyone else had this problem? I'm afraid that the "shedding period" isnt going to end. I'm afraid that if I keep using Rogaine I am just speeding up the balding process.

6 MONTH UPDATE:

Hi Guys,

I am writing back with my 6 month update. At this point I have been on Finasteride (5mg pill cut up into 4's; basically taking 1.25mg/day) for 11 months and Rogaine (2 x day) for 7 months and dont think that there has been any improvement. My hair still sheds like crazy. Every time I run my fingers through, a bunch of hairs fall out. I'm debating stopping the Rogaine because I think that it may be doing more harm than good. Is that possible?

I really am giving this my all. I'm eating healthier and quit smoking, so I really hope that I start to see some positive results, but it seems that my hairs just keep getting thinner and thinner.

Mw1539's Story - 10 MONTH UPDATE

Hey guys,

I haven't checked in for awhile, so I figured I'd post an update. I stopped using rogaine about a month ago because there seemed to be a direct relationship between my shedding and applying rogaine. There was a crazy amount of hair on my hands after every time I applied it. So at the moment, I am just using finasteride and have been using it for about 14 months.

I think things definitely look better than a year ago, but I'm not sure by how much. I feel like im getting balder by the day, but then I come back and look at these pictures and they make me think otherwise. I recommend that everyone keep an ongoing post with their progress. It's a good little boost to check out every once in a while.
